Edgar W. Clark fought in 13 of the most famous battles of the Civil War for the 3rd Michigan Infantry Regiment. Over 40 days of combat, he survived the battles of Fredericksburg, Chancellorsville, Gettysburg, Spotsylvania and Petersburg. He was shot in the left knee at Petersburg and survived amputation and gangrene. Thanks to 181 letters sent home to his wife, Catherine, in Lansing, Mich., his great-great-grandson, Michael P. Clark, takes us on Edgar’s journey, including commentary on the military, political and social issues of the time. WEB PHOTO: Monument to 3rd Michigan in Peach Orchard at Gettysburg. Private Edgar W. Clark's 3rd Michigan Infantry is involved in the controversial move of Gen. Daniel Sickles at Hazel Grove during the Battle of Chancellorsville. He was in the middle of a chaotic night attack in which Union soldiers fired on each other. For more info on this project, see the website: civilwarsurvivor.com.
